Weekend Janitor information

What is a weekend janitor?

A Weekend Janitor is responsible for cleaning and maintaining a facility during the weekends. Duties typically include sweeping, mopping, trash removal, restroom sanitation, and restocking supplies. This role ensures that the premises remain clean and presentable for employees or customers. Weekend Janitors may work in offices, schools, retail stores, or other commercial buildings. Attention to detail and the ability to work independently are important for success in this position.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the weekend janitor position?

To thrive as a Weekend Janitor, you need reliable cleaning skills, attention to detail, and the physical stamina required for custodial work; a high school diploma or equivalent is often preferred but not always required. Familiarity with cleaning chemicals, tools such as floor buffers or vacuums, and workplace safety protocols like OSHA guidelines is beneficial. Being punctual, self-motivated, and possessing good communication skills can greatly enhance performance in this role. These skills are important to maintain a clean, safe, and welcoming environment for all facility users, even during off-peak hours.

What are the typical working hours and expectations for a weekend janitor?

Weekend Janitor roles usually involve shifts on Saturdays and Sundays, with hours depending on the facility’s needs—sometimes early mornings, late evenings, or split shifts. You may be responsible for a set area or multiple zones, and tasks can include sweeping, mopping, trash removal, restroom sanitization, and restocking supplies. Flexibility and reliability are highly valued, as weekend periods often require independent work with minimal direct supervision. Many employers provide an orientation or training on specific cleaning procedures and equipment. This role can be a great way to gain experience in facilities maintenance and may offer opportunities for additional weekday shifts or advancement over time.

Do weekend janitors work overnight?

Weekend janitors often work overnight shifts, especially if cleaning is scheduled after business hours or during the night to avoid disrupting daily operations. The specific hours can vary depending on the employer and the facility's needs, but overnight work is common for weekend janitors. Skills in time management and safety procedures are important for these shifts.

Get to Know Gateway

Gateway Casinos & Entertainment Limited (?Gateway?) is one of the largest and most diversified gaming and entertainment companies in Canada. Across its 27 gaming properties in British Columbia, Ontario and Edmonton, Alberta, Gateway currently employs approximately 8,648 people and boasts approximately 448 table games (including 49 poker tables), 13,887 slots, 85 restaurants and bars and 561 hotel rooms. Gateway is the service provider for the Central, Southwest and North gaming Bundles in Ontario, which includes 11 properties in their portfolio. A multi-pronged growth strategy has seen Gateway diversify and expand its product offering, including developing proprietary casino and restaurant brands, dramatically improving the gaming customer experience while attracting new customers. Some of Gateway's proprietary brands include Match Eatery & Public House, Atlas Steak + Fish and the new Halley's Club. In 2017, Gateway celebrated 25 years in the business of gaming and entertainment in Canada. Further information is available at www.gatewaycasinos.com.
